Zurück   IP-Symcon Community Forum > IP-Symcon Technik > Haustechnik

Antwort
 
LinkBack Themen-Optionen Thema durchsuchen
  #21 (permalink)  
Alt 26.06.10, 17:15
Benutzerbild von bmwm3
Senior Member
 
Registriert seit: Jul 2006
Ort: Butzbach, die schöne Wetterau
Beiträge: 1,037
Standard

stimmt, Sorry
__________________
Gruß Uwe

Hausautomations-BLOG auf LiveSpaces

<a href=http://edip2008.spaces.live.com/default.aspx?mkt=de-DE&partner=Live.Spaces target=_blank><font color=DarkOrange>Hausautomations-BLOG auf LiveSpaces</font></a>
Mit Zitat antworten
  #22 (permalink)  
Alt 26.06.10, 17:47
Senior Member
 
Registriert seit: Jun 2010
Beiträge: 151
Standard

...dann nehm ich mal die - siehe Anhang..

Geändert von RWN (26.06.10 um 18:21 Uhr) Grund: anhang gelöscht
Mit Zitat antworten
  #23 (permalink)  
Alt 26.06.10, 17:59
Benutzerbild von RWN
RWN RWN ist offline
Super Moderator
 
Registriert seit: Jan 2007
Ort: Nidda(Hessen)
Beiträge: 5,970
Standard

fast. kommen ja nicht alle auf einmal.

nimm mal das.

PHP-Code:
$txt IPS_GetKernelDir()."waermepumpe.txt";
$daten  RegVar_GetBuffer($IPS_INSTANCE);
$daten .= $IPS_VALUE;
for(
$i 0$i count($daten); $i++)
{
    
$fp fopen($txt"wb+");
    
fwrite($fp$daten);
}
fclose($fp); 
__________________
Gruß Rainer


Unmögliches wird sofort erledigt, Wunder dauern etwas länger.


Geändert von RWN (26.06.10 um 18:19 Uhr)
Mit Zitat antworten
  #24 (permalink)  
Alt 26.06.10, 18:06
Senior Member
 
Registriert seit: Jun 2010
Beiträge: 151
Standard

..kein Unterschied, genau der gleiche Inhalt..
Mit Zitat antworten
  #25 (permalink)  
Alt 26.06.10, 18:20
Benutzerbild von RWN
RWN RWN ist offline
Super Moderator
 
Registriert seit: Jan 2007
Ort: Nidda(Hessen)
Beiträge: 5,970
Standard

ich habe es oben noch mal geändert, probier es damit noch mal aus.
__________________
Gruß Rainer


Unmögliches wird sofort erledigt, Wunder dauern etwas länger.

Mit Zitat antworten
  #26 (permalink)  
Alt 26.06.10, 18:40
Senior Member
 
Registriert seit: Jun 2010
Beiträge: 151
Standard

..hat sich nix getan...
Mit Zitat antworten
  #27 (permalink)  
Alt 02.07.10, 14:14
Senior Member
 
Registriert seit: Jun 2010
Beiträge: 151
Exclamation IPS überfordert?

Hallo,

kann das wirklich sein, dass diese Situation mit IPS nicht zu bewältigen ist...??? Inwieweit wäre es möglich, die Daten aus der RegVar so zu bearbeiten, dass nur noch die Datensätze mit dem ":" übrig bleiben?

Gruß, Kay.
Mit Zitat antworten
  #28 (permalink)  
Alt 02.07.10, 14:43
Benutzerbild von RWN
RWN RWN ist offline
Super Moderator
 
Registriert seit: Jan 2007
Ort: Nidda(Hessen)
Beiträge: 5,970
Standard

......nicht IPS, sondern Du.

Zitat:
Inwieweit wäre es möglich, die Daten aus der RegVar so zu bearbeiten, dass nur noch die Datensätze mit dem ":" übrig bleiben?
indem Du deine Hausaufgaben machst. In den beiden Beispielen für die RegVar steht eigentlich alles drinnen was Du benötigst.

Wenn ich deine Anlage hätte, würde ich dir ja das Script schreiben aber ist nicht so also musst Du so durch.
__________________
Gruß Rainer


Unmögliches wird sofort erledigt, Wunder dauern etwas länger.

Mit Zitat antworten
  #29 (permalink)  
Alt 02.07.10, 17:56
Senior Member
 
Registriert seit: Jun 2010
Beiträge: 151
Standard

hihi..der war gut....
Mit Zitat antworten
  #30 (permalink)  
Alt 05.07.10, 02:13
Senior Member
 
Registriert seit: Jun 2007
Beiträge: 658
Standard

Hi Kabo,

Hab den Thread grad grob überflogen

ich versuch dir meine Lösung mal mit Worten auf deine WP zu übertragen.
Also ich lass meine Pumpe nicht von selber blubbern, da bekommst innerhalb von Minuten eine riesen Menge daten, die du garnicht so in der Form vermutlich brauchen wirst. Ich schicke meiner Pumpe einmal pro Minute die 1800, in deinem fall ist das glaub ich "M"+CR/LF. Jetzt blubbert die Pumpe in die Registervariable los und sendet einmalig alle Daten aus der Anlage (Vorlauf, Rücklauf, Relaisstände, etc.). Alles in allem ca. 60 Werte. Diese Werte lass ich von der Registervariablen in eine Stringvariable schreiben. Sobald das Auslesen fertig ist leere ich die Registervariable auch.

Nun hast einen String mit deinen Anlagendaten. Wenn ich richtig sehe immer durch ":" getrennt. Würde aus deiner Stringvariablen nun einen Array erstmal machen wo ich bei jedem ":" trenne. Wenn Du da bist, bist.... aus meiner Sicht... m al ein Stück weiter! :-)

Ich würde aber das natürliche senden der Pumpe versuchen zu unterbinden, nur unnötig viele Daten die du vermutlich eh nicht so brauchst!

Gruß

Kai

Nachtrag: Also meine Pumpe läuft mit 57600 Baut, und blubbert ca. 2 Sekunden für einen Datensatz. Wenn deine mit 9600 läuft, also ca. 1/6 würde die eh für die gleiche Menge (nur mal angenommen) 12 Sekunden brauchen. Überleg dir mal ob du so einen kontinuierlichen Datenstrom brauchst, oder ob da nicht alle 60 Sekunden reichen würde!

Geändert von kadorf (05.07.10 um 02:17 Uhr)
Mit Zitat antworten
Antwort

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Neues Interface FHT 8I RWN Sonstige Funkkomponenten / Wetterstationen 108 11.01.12 00:27
RS232 Gerät über Touchdisplay bedienen? markus1 Bastel-Ecke 6 29.03.10 20:30
DUG Tool - externe Daten hínzufügen stevih Scripte, PHP, SQL 0 14.12.09 22:21
RS232 Daten parsen tomtom Allgemeine Diskussion 1 21.05.09 10:07
FS20-Enhanced in IPS einbinden Crazy_Hardware Ideen & Anregungen 0 11.06.05 18:20


Alle Zeitangaben in WEZ +1. Es ist jetzt 19:48 Uhr.


Powered by vBulletin® Version 3.8.4 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.6.0